November 2009: CDG Advisor Donna M. Wells passes.

December 6, 2009 by Marvin Jones Leave a Comment

 I sought out Donna when I was shopping around for advice about the research I was collecting on the Winton Triangle. Her reputation as a respected archivist at Howard University’s Moorland- Springarn Research Center was long known to me. It was Donna who planted the idea of creating a non-profit organization. All along the way she encouraged me, was always interested in the work and continued to advise me. I’ll always be thankful for her friendship and help. – Marvin T. Jones
